During a late summer day in Maine, two elderly sisters reminisce about life and the bygone days.
Starring: Bette Davis, Lillian Gish, Vincent Price.
Directed By: Lindsay Anderson.

This very meaningful movie (for various reasons) made in 1987 and to think that Bette Davis passed two years later (age 81) shows her tremendous acting abilities. I read her authobiography and she is my favourite actress ever. Her last movie was Wicked Stepmother in 1989 working to the very end of her life. Lillia Gish lived a long life to 99 years of age passing in 1993 the same year as Vincent Price. The Whales of August was the last movie she acted in. Thank you very much for uploading the movie !!
